The 2020 Audi Q7 45TDI is a reliably built diesel SUV, with an 88.5% first-time MOT pass rate that comfortably exceeds the UK average of 80%—and diesel variants perform even slightly better at 88.8%. However, nearly 13% of these vehicles have recorded a dangerous defect at some point, which is a meaningful concern for a buyer considering used examples.
At just under 40,000 miles on average, these Q7s are still relatively young, and the low failure rate of 0.31 per vehicle suggests the diesel engine and major systems are holding up well. If you're viewing one, focus your pre-purchase inspection on the advisory items that average 2.8 per vehicle—typically wear items like brakes and suspension—rather than expecting structural problems, but do request full service history to verify regular maintenance of this complex German SUV.

Half of all 2020 Audi Q7 Sln Blk Ed 45tdi MHEV Qto A vehicles fall between 31,758 and 48,349 miles.

Almost all 2020 Audi Q7 Sln Blk Ed 45tdi MHEV Qto As are still on the road.
Strong survival — 208 vehicles still getting MOTs in 2025, 92% of the peak.
Based on vehicles from this manufacture year that had at least one MOT test in each calendar year. Data from 2022–2025.
